Beta Frequency: Active, Analytical Focus
Beta brainwaves (12 to 30 Hz) are the dominant frequency during normal waking consciousness. When beta activity is healthy and balanced, you feel mentally sharp, able to concentrate, and capable of sustained analytical work. When beta is dysregulated — too high — it produces anxiety, overthinking, and mental exhaustion.
